+/* About to edit the service. */\r
+int pre_edit_service(int argc, TCHAR **argv) {\r
+ /* Require service name. */\r
+ if (argc < 1) return usage(1);\r
+\r
+ nssm_service_t *service = alloc_nssm_service();\r
+ _sntprintf_s(service->name, _countof(service->name), _TRUNCATE, _T("%s"), argv[0]);\r
+\r
+ /* Open service manager */\r
+ SC_HANDLE services = open_service_manager();\r
+ if (! services) {\r
+ print_message(stderr, NSSM_MESSAGE_OPEN_SERVICE_MANAGER_FAILED);\r
+ return 2;\r
+ }\r
+\r
+ /* Try to open the service */\r
+ service->handle = OpenService(services, service->name, SC_MANAGER_ALL_ACCESS);\r
+ if (! service->handle) {\r
+ CloseServiceHandle(services);\r
+ print_message(stderr, NSSM_MESSAGE_OPENSERVICE_FAILED);\r
+ return 3;\r
+ }\r
+\r
+ /* Get system details. */\r
+ unsigned long bufsize;\r
+ unsigned long error;\r
+ QUERY_SERVICE_CONFIG *qsc;\r
+\r
+ QueryServiceConfig(service->handle, 0, 0, &bufsize);\r
+ error = GetLastError();\r
+ if (error == ERROR_INSUFFICIENT_BUFFER) {\r
+ qsc = (QUERY_SERVICE_CONFIG *) HeapAlloc(GetProcessHeap(), HEAP_ZERO_MEMORY, bufsize);\r
+ if (! qsc) {\r
+ print_message(stderr, NSSM_EVENT_OUT_OF_MEMORY, _T("QUERY_SERVICE_CONFIG"), _T("pre_edit_service()"), 0);\r
+ return 4;\r
+ }\r
+ }\r
+ else {\r
+ CloseHandle(service->handle);\r
+ CloseServiceHandle(services);\r
+ print_message(stderr, NSSM_MESSAGE_QUERYSERVICECONFIG_FAILED, service->name, error_string(error), 0);\r
+ return 4;\r
+ }\r
+\r
+ if (! QueryServiceConfig(service->handle, qsc, bufsize, &bufsize)) {\r
+ HeapFree(GetProcessHeap(), 0, qsc);\r
+ CloseHandle(service->handle);\r
+ CloseServiceHandle(services);\r
+ print_message(stderr, NSSM_MESSAGE_QUERYSERVICECONFIG_FAILED, service->name, error_string(GetLastError()), 0);\r
+ return 4;\r
+ }\r
+\r
+ service->type = qsc->dwServiceType;\r
+ if (! (service->type & SERVICE_WIN32_OWN_PROCESS)) {\r
+ HeapFree(GetProcessHeap(), 0, qsc);\r
+ CloseHandle(service->handle);\r
+ CloseServiceHandle(services);\r
+ print_message(stderr, NSSM_MESSAGE_CANNOT_EDIT, service->name, _T("SERVICE_WIN32_OWN_PROCESS"), 0);\r
+ return 3;\r
+ }\r
+\r
+ switch (qsc->dwStartType) {\r
+ case SERVICE_DEMAND_START: service->startup = NSSM_STARTUP_MANUAL; break;\r
+ case SERVICE_DISABLED: service->startup = NSSM_STARTUP_DISABLED; break;\r
+ default: service->startup = NSSM_STARTUP_AUTOMATIC;\r
+ }\r
+ if (! str_equiv(qsc->lpServiceStartName, NSSM_LOCALSYSTEM_ACCOUNT)) {\r
+ size_t len = _tcslen(qsc->lpServiceStartName);\r
+ service->username = (TCHAR *) HeapAlloc(GetProcessHeap(), 0, (len + 1) * sizeof(TCHAR));\r
+ if (service->username) {\r
+ memmove(service->username, qsc->lpServiceStartName, (len + 1) * sizeof(TCHAR));\r
+ service->usernamelen = (unsigned long) len;\r
+ }\r
+ else {\r
+ HeapFree(GetProcessHeap(), 0, qsc);\r
+ CloseHandle(service->handle);\r
+ CloseServiceHandle(services);\r
+ print_message(stderr, NSSM_EVENT_OUT_OF_MEMORY, _T("username"), _T("pre_edit_service()"));\r
+ return 4;\r
+ }\r
+ }\r
+ _sntprintf_s(service->displayname, _countof(service->displayname), _TRUNCATE, _T("%s"), qsc->lpDisplayName);\r
+\r
+ /* Get the canonical service name. We open it case insensitively. */\r
+ bufsize = _countof(service->name);\r
+ GetServiceKeyName(services, service->displayname, service->name, &bufsize);\r
+\r
+ /* Remember the executable in case it isn't NSSM. */\r
+ _sntprintf_s(service->image, _countof(service->image), _TRUNCATE, _T("%s"), qsc->lpBinaryPathName);\r
+ HeapFree(GetProcessHeap(), 0, qsc);\r
+\r
+ /* Get extended system details. */\r
+ if (service->startup == NSSM_STARTUP_AUTOMATIC) {\r
+ QueryServiceConfig2(service->handle, SERVICE_CONFIG_DELAYED_AUTO_START_INFO, 0, 0, &bufsize);\r
+ error = GetLastError();\r
+ if (error == ERROR_INSUFFICIENT_BUFFER) {\r
+ SERVICE_DELAYED_AUTO_START_INFO *info = (SERVICE_DELAYED_AUTO_START_INFO *) HeapAlloc(GetProcessHeap(), 0, bufsize);\r
+ if (! info) {\r
+ CloseHandle(service->handle);\r
+ CloseServiceHandle(services);\r
+ print_message(stderr, NSSM_EVENT_OUT_OF_MEMORY, _T("SERVICE_DELAYED_AUTO_START_INFO"), _T("pre_edit_service()"));\r
+ return 5;\r
+ }\r
+\r
+ if (QueryServiceConfig2(service->handle, SERVICE_CONFIG_DELAYED_AUTO_START_INFO, (unsigned char *) info, bufsize, &bufsize)) {\r
+ if (info->fDelayedAutostart) service->startup = NSSM_STARTUP_DELAYED;\r
+ }\r
+ else {\r
+ error = GetLastError();\r
+ if (error != ERROR_INVALID_LEVEL) {\r
+ CloseHandle(service->handle);\r
+ CloseServiceHandle(services);\r
+ print_message(stderr, NSSM_MESSAGE_QUERYSERVICECONFIG2_FAILED, service->name, _T("SERVICE_CONFIG_DELAYED_AUTO_START_INFO"), error_string(error));\r
+ return 5;\r
+ }\r
+ }\r
+ }\r
+ else if (error != ERROR_INVALID_LEVEL) {\r
+ CloseHandle(service->handle);\r
+ CloseServiceHandle(services);\r
+ print_message(stderr, NSSM_MESSAGE_QUERYSERVICECONFIG2_FAILED, service->name, _T("SERVICE_DELAYED_AUTO_START_INFO"), error_string(error));\r
+ return 5;\r
+ }\r
+ }\r
+\r
+ QueryServiceConfig2(service->handle, SERVICE_CONFIG_DESCRIPTION, 0, 0, &bufsize);\r
+ error = GetLastError();\r
+ if (error == ERROR_INSUFFICIENT_BUFFER) {\r
+ SERVICE_DESCRIPTION *description = (SERVICE_DESCRIPTION *) HeapAlloc(GetProcessHeap(), 0, bufsize);\r
+ if (! description) {\r
+ CloseHandle(service->handle);\r
+ CloseServiceHandle(services);\r
+ print_message(stderr, NSSM_EVENT_OUT_OF_MEMORY, _T("SERVICE_CONFIG_DESCRIPTION"), _T("pre_edit_service()"));\r
+ return 6;\r
+ }\r
+\r
+ if (QueryServiceConfig2(service->handle, SERVICE_CONFIG_DESCRIPTION, (unsigned char *) description, bufsize, &bufsize)) {\r
+ if (description->lpDescription) _sntprintf_s(service->description, _countof(service->description), _TRUNCATE, _T("%s"), description->lpDescription);\r
+ HeapFree(GetProcessHeap(), 0, description);\r
+ }\r
+ else {\r
+ HeapFree(GetProcessHeap(), 0, description);\r
+ CloseHandle(service->handle);\r
+ CloseServiceHandle(services);\r
+ print_message(stderr, NSSM_MESSAGE_QUERYSERVICECONFIG2_FAILED, service->name, _T("SERVICE_CONFIG_DELAYED_AUTO_START_INFO"), error_string(error));\r
+ return 6;\r
+ }\r
+ }\r
+ else {\r
+ CloseHandle(service->handle);\r
+ CloseServiceHandle(services);\r
+ print_message(stderr, NSSM_MESSAGE_QUERYSERVICECONFIG2_FAILED, service->name, _T("SERVICE_CONFIG_DELAYED_AUTO_START_INFO"), error_string(error));\r
+ return 6;\r
+ }\r
+\r
+ /* Get NSSM details. */\r
+ get_parameters(service, 0);\r
+\r
+ CloseServiceHandle(services);\r
+\r
+ if (! service->exe[0]) {\r
+ print_message(stderr, NSSM_MESSAGE_INVALID_SERVICE, service->name, NSSM, service->image);\r
+ service->native = true;\r
+ }\r
+\r
+ nssm_gui(IDD_EDIT, service);\r
+\r
+ return 0;\r
